Description:
This DMVPN topology currently runs RIPv2 as its routing choice, the owner of this network wants the network to converge faster than it has now, he/she learned about OSPF protocol's better performance, you were asked to assist in this project. Successful completion of this lab will be requiring you to implement OSPF without loss of any transit data and any downtime. This lab is similar to the previous RIPv2-to-EIGRP transition lab.
